If Thomas gets a score of 76% on his exam and there were 150 questions on the exam, how many correct answers did you get?

To find the number of answer he got correct you will multiply 0.76 by 150.

0.76 * 150 = 114

To check it:

114/150 = 0.76 * 100 = 76%
